Dwi Ana Ratnawati is a researcher dedicated to advancing robotics education and accessible research platforms. Her key contributions center on developing low-cost, open-source mobile robot systems that lower barriers to entry in robotics. Her most cited work, "CEPI: A low cost and open source mobile robot platform for research and education" (2018), introduces a practical, easy-to-implement platform designed to support emerging applications in robot coordination, cooperation, and human-robot interaction. This work has garnered 4 citations, reflecting its growing relevance in educational and research settings.
